Methods for building robust feature engineering pipelines that are reproducible, documented, and governed for model training.
In the fast-moving world of data science, teams benefit from disciplined feature engineering pipelines that emphasize reproducibility, thorough documentation, and clear governance to enable trusted model training and sustained performance.
Published August 07, 2025
Facebook X Reddit Pinterest Email
Building robust feature engineering pipelines starts with a clear, shared definition of each feature’s purpose and lifecycle. Teams benefit from a standardized naming convention, strict data type constraints, and explicit handling instructions for missing values, outliers, and edge cases. Early in the design phase, it is essential to document the provenance of every feature, including the raw data source, transformation steps, version numbers, and validation checks. By codifying these elements, organizations reduce ambiguity, simplify troubleshooting, and lay a foundation for repeatable experiments. A well-structured pipeline also supports auditability, an increasingly important criterion for regulated domains and cross-functional collaboration.
Reproducibility hinges on deterministic transformations and environment stability. To achieve this, teams should pin software dependencies, capture runtime configurations, and version-control data schemas alongside code. Automated pipelines that run end-to-end on a schedule or on demand ensure that results are consistent across runs. Operators must implement monolithic and modular tests that verify data quality, feature stability, and downstream model impact. By decoupling feature extraction from model training, teams can independently verify each stage, quickly rerun experiments with different parameters, and compare outcomes with confidence. This discipline minimizes drift and raises the baseline for reliable production systems.
Reproducible design, governance, and documentation reinforce resilient analytics practices.
Documentation acts as a contract between developers, analysts, and stakeholders, detailing how features are derived, transformed, and validated. It should describe not only the technical steps but also the business rationale behind each feature. Metadata such as feature age, data freshness, lag, and acceptable ranges help data scientists understand when and how a feature should be used. A living document that evolves with changes to data sources or transformation logic prevents misinterpretation during onboarding or handoffs. Teams should also maintain lineage graphs, which map every feature to its origin and the model that consumes it, making impact analysis straightforward when updates occur.
ADVERTISEMENT
ADVERTISEMENT
Governance mechanisms enforce consistency and safety in feature pipelines. Role-based access controls limit who can modify data sources, feature definitions, or model training pipelines. Change management processes require peer review, testing in staging environments, and approval before promoting artifacts to production. Standardized templates for feature definitions reduce variability and improve cross-team communication. Regular audits identify anomalies, misalignments, or unauthorized alterations. By formalizing these practices, organizations create a durable framework for evolving features as business needs shift, regulatory expectations become stricter, or new data sources emerge.
Automation fortifies the reliability and observability of feature systems.
A robust feature library consolidates reusable components into a centralized, well-documented repository. This library should categorize features by domain, data domain, and dependency structure, offering clear usage guidelines and compatibility notes. Versioning enables researchers to pin a feature across experiments or revert to a prior implementation when necessary. Dependency graphs reveal how features relate, preventing circular transformations and minimizing hidden side effects. A searchable catalog with example notebooks accelerates adoption, limits duplicate effort, and provides a single source of truth for everyone from data engineers to business analysts.
ADVERTISEMENT
ADVERTISEMENT
Automated validation and quality checks are indispensable in feature pipelines. Implement data quality gates that trigger alerts when upstream data deviates beyond predefined thresholds. Feature-level tests should verify mathematical properties, monotonicity where appropriate, and cross-filter consistency. Statistical drift detection helps identify when a feature’s distribution changes in production, enabling proactive remediation. By coupling these checks with continuous integration, teams can catch regressions early, maintain high confidence in model inputs, and reduce the risk of degraded performance after deployment.
Transparent experiment provenance and repeatable workflows underpin trust.
Instrumentation and observability provide visibility into the health of feature pipelines. Key metrics include data freshness, feature computation latency, and the fraction of failed feature generations. Centralized dashboards help teams spot bottlenecks, plan capacity, and communicate status during releases. Tracing end-to-end pipelines clarifies where delays occur, whether in data ingestion, feature extraction, or staging for model training. Alerts configured with sensible thresholds prevent alert fatigue while ensuring timely responses. By pairing observability with automated remediation, organizations reduce downtime and keep models aligned with current data realities.
A culture of reproducibility requires disciplined experiment tracking. Every run should capture the exact feature definitions, data versions, hyperparameters, and evaluation metrics used. Lightweight, shareable notebooks or report artifacts enable stakeholders to review results without recalculating from scratch. When experiments are reproducible, teams can confidently compare alternatives, justify choices to governance bodies, and build a historical record for audit purposes. Moreover, experiment provenance supports post-hoc analyses, such as understanding feature contributions to model performance or tracing the source of a surprising outcome to a data issue.
ADVERTISEMENT
ADVERTISEMENT
Long-term value grows from disciplined discipline, transparency, and accountability.
Data engineering teams should adopt standardized feature packaging and deployment procedures. Packaging encapsulates feature logic, dependencies, and environment settings, simplifying promotion from development to production. A strict promotion policy, with stage gates and rollback options, minimizes disruption and accelerates incident response. Feature toggles allow rapid experimentation without permanently altering production pipelines. Documentation should accompany each deployment, flagging any changes in data sources, preprocessing steps, or feature interactions that could influence model behavior. As pipelines mature, automation around packaging and deployment becomes a strategic differentiator, enabling faster, safer model iteration.
Stakeholder alignment is essential for sustainable feature governance. Product owners and data scientists must agree on what constitutes a “good” feature, how it should be validated, and what thresholds trigger retraining. A quarterly review of feature performance, coupled with business impact assessments, helps ensure features remain aligned with objectives. Clear escalation paths for data quality issues foster accountability and speedier resolution. By embedding governance discussions into regular cadences, organizations keep feature engineering relevant, compliant, and responsive to evolving business needs while maintaining trust with customers and regulators.
Training pipelines must include safeguards against data leakage and target leakage. Feature construction should be designed to mimic real-world deployment conditions, with careful handling of time-based splits and leakage-avoiding strategies. Regular backtesting, out-of-sample validation, and walk-forward analyses provide evidence of robustness across market regimes or changing environments. Documentation should record potential leakage risks and the steps taken to mitigate them, reinforcing confidence in reported metrics. As models are updated, maintaining a strict changelog helps stakeholders understand how feature engineering evolved and why decisions changed over time.
Ultimately, the goal is a repeatable, well-documented, governed system that scales with data complexity. By prioritizing provenance, reproducibility, governance, and observability, organizations create pipelines that not only perform today but adapt to tomorrow’s data challenges. The payoff includes faster experimentation cycles, easier collaboration across teams, and greater trust from users who rely on model-driven decisions. When teams commit to disciplined practices, feature engineering becomes a durable asset rather than a brittle process, sustaining performance and compliance across evolving business landscapes.
Related Articles
Tech trends
A practical, evergreen guide detailing resilient offline strategies for modern web apps, including local storage patterns, conflict resolution, background sync, and user-centric cues that maintain accuracy and trust.
-
July 21, 2025
Tech trends
Multi-agent systems demonstrate resilient collaboration as diverse agents assign roles, share strategies, and align goals through structured communication, adaptive protocols, and consensus mechanisms that sustain progress under uncertainty.
-
August 12, 2025
Tech trends
A clear explanation of privacy-preserving identity federation, its core mechanisms, and the practical privacy advantages it brings to everyday digital authentication across diverse online services.
-
July 23, 2025
Tech trends
Building durable data labeling workflows demands disciplined processes, clear role definitions, scalable tooling, rigorous quality controls, and ongoing feedback loops that together ensure consistent, accurate, and useful training data for machine learning systems.
-
July 26, 2025
Tech trends
As conversational search evolves, assistants increasingly interpret context, track prior dialogue, and use strategic follow-up questions to deliver precise, relevant results that address layered information needs with greater accuracy and efficiency.
-
July 19, 2025
Tech trends
This article explores how explainable AI empowers domain experts to understand model reasoning, trust outcomes, and implement responsible practices across regulated fields by translating complex signals into actionable, ethical guidance.
-
July 15, 2025
Tech trends
This evergreen guide outlines a practical approach to instrumenting meaningful events, selecting outcome-driven metrics, and turning telemetry into tangible product decisions that improve user value over time.
-
July 15, 2025
Tech trends
As artificial intelligence systems operate across dynamic landscapes, continual learning strategies emerge as a cornerstone for preserving knowledge while adapting to new tasks, domains, and data distributions without losing previously acquired competencies.
-
August 11, 2025
Tech trends
Data transfers across borders demand layered protections. This evergreen guide explains contractual commitments, technical controls, and organizational practices that uphold privacy rights while enabling global collaboration and innovation.
-
July 16, 2025
Tech trends
Balancing datasets ethically demands deliberate sampling, thoughtful augmentation, and continuous human oversight to minimize bias, improve generalization, and build trustworthy AI systems that reflect diverse perspectives and real-world use cases.
-
July 15, 2025
Tech trends
This evergreen guide explores practical principles for reducing energy use in everyday devices by optimizing power states, scheduling workloads intelligently, and aligning hardware capabilities with user needs for sustained efficiency gains.
-
July 29, 2025
Tech trends
This evergreen exploration examines practical methods to embed sustainability metrics into engineering KPIs, ensuring energy-aware design, responsible resource usage, and cross-team accountability that aligns technical excellence with environmental stewardship across complex product ecosystems.
-
July 30, 2025
Tech trends
Privacy-preserving benchmarks enable fair comparisons without exposing confidential data, balancing rigorous evaluation with responsible data handling, and supporting researchers and organizations as they navigate sensitive proprietary content in model development.
-
July 15, 2025
Tech trends
Developers seek APIs that feel natural to use, with clear contracts, thorough docs, and security baked in from day one, ensuring faster adoption, fewer errors, and stronger partnerships across ecosystems.
-
August 09, 2025
Tech trends
This evergreen piece explores disciplined pruning, quantization, and structured compression strategies that preserve model integrity while enabling efficient edge deployment, reliability, and scalability across diverse hardware environments.
-
July 28, 2025
Tech trends
Edge computing orchestration coordinates distributed workloads, lifecycle management, and policy enforcement across diverse edge, fog, and cloud environments, enabling dynamic, scalable operations with unified control and resilient performance.
-
August 07, 2025
Tech trends
This evergreen guide explores pragmatic, user friendly AR strategies that empower shoppers to visualize products, compare options, and complete purchases with confidence, while retailers build stronger brand loyalty and personalized journeys.
-
August 11, 2025
Tech trends
This evergreen guide explores practical, scalable approaches to federated governance, balancing local decision-making with a cohesive, shared toolkit and uniform standards across diverse teams and regions.
-
July 25, 2025
Tech trends
Designing onboarding flows for IoT devices demands robust identity verification, minimal user friction, and strict protection of secrets; this evergreen guide outlines practical, security‑driven approaches that scale across devices and ecosystems.
-
July 18, 2025
Tech trends
This evergreen guide outlines robust techniques to design deterministic, ultra-fast data pipelines capable of sustaining millisecond responsiveness in financial trading environments, while addressing reliability, scalability, and predictable latency under load.
-
July 29, 2025